Grille Pullover
An openwork grid-like stitch pattern worked in DK-weight wool makes this layering piece breathable yet warm. Drop-shoulder sleeves and a bit of positive ease give this sweater a casual, ultimately wearable feel. Throw it on over a button-up shirt, tee, or dress—the possibilities are endless!
Difficulty Easy
Finished Size 35¾ (40¾, 45¾, 51, 56, 61)“ bust circumference. Sample shown measures 40¾”, modeled with 7¼“ ease.
Yarn Universal Yarn Deluxe DK Superwash (100% superwash wool; 284 yd 259 m/3½ oz 100 g): #843 rust heather, 5 (6, 7, 7, 8, 9) balls.
Hook Size 7 (4.5 mm). Adjust hook size if necessary to obtain correct gauge.
Notions Yarn needle.
Gauge 6 mesh and 9½ rows = 4” in mesh patt.
For techniques you don’t know, please visit our online crochet glossary at https://www.interweave.com/interweave-crochet-glossary/
NOTES
- Front, back, and sleeves are worked flat from the bottom up. An edging that resembles knitted I-cord is added to the sleeves, neck, and hem.
